MunsellToLab
Converts a
Munsell specification to CIE Lab coordinates, by interpolating over the
extrapolated Munsell renotation data
MunsellToLab( MunsellSpec, white='D65', adapt='Bradford', ... )
MunsellSpec |
a numeric Nx3 matrix with HVC values in the rows, or a vector that can be converted to such a matrix, by row. |
white |
XYZ for the source white - a numeric 3-vector with scaling irrelevant.
|
adapt |
method for chromatic adaptation, see |
... |
other parameters passed to |
The conversion is done in these steps:
HVC → XYZ using MunsellToXYZ()
XYZ is adapted from Illuminant C to the given white
using spacesXYZ::adaptXYZ()
and the given chromatic adaptation method
XYZ → Lab using spacesXYZ::LabfromXYZ()
with the given white
An Nx3 matrix with the Lab coordinates in each row.
The rownames of Lab are copied from the input HVC matrix,
unless the rownames are NULL
and
then the output rownames are the Munsell notations for HVC.
